Anda di halaman 1dari 20

Sistem Database

Universitas PGRI Adi Buana Surabaya


Rizka Anggrainy
... 01 191600066
A
N
Fitria Septy N
G 02 191600088
G
OT
A.. Afidah Sal Sabila
. 03 191600091

Aulia Rahmayanti
04 191600104
Peta Konsep

Informasi Database Database Database


Relasional Berorientasi Objek
PENGERTIAN
markas atau gudang,
tempat bersarang
atau berkumpul

DATA BASIS

B A

Representasi fakta
dunia nyata yang
mewakilkan suatu
objek yang direkam
dalam bentuk angka,
huruf simbol, teks,
gambar, bunyi, atau
kombinasinya
Sistem database merupakan
C.J. Date
suatu system yang dapat
menyusun dan mengelola
record-record menggunakan
computer untuk menyimpan atau
merekam data operasional Sistem database pada
lengkap sebuah organisasi/ dasarnya dapat dianggap
perusahaan sehingga mampu sebagai tempat atau lokasi
menyediakan informasi yang PARA untuk sekumpulan berkas
optimal yang diperlukan data yang sudah
pemakai untuk proses AHLI terkomputerisasi dengan
mengambil keputusan tujuan untuk memelihara
informasi, dan juga memuat
informasi tersebut, terutama
apabila informasi tersebut
sedang dibutuhkan

Rogayah
Database

SIMPULAN
kumpulan file / table yang saling berelasi
(berhubungan) yang disimpan dalam media
penyimpan elektronik untuk memenuhi kebutuhan
informasi suatu enterprise (dunia usaha)
Data VS Informasi
Skema
Internal
- Catatan Persediaan
- Catatan Penjualan

Konseptual
- Pengeluaran Kas
- Penerimaan Kas
- Penjualan, dll

Eksternal
- Diagram
-Tabel
- Kata-kata
Jenis
Database

DATABASE DATABASE
RELASIONAL BERORIENTASI
OBJEK
KOLOM
DatabaseRelasio
nal

Database yang fokus utamanya pada tabel dua


dimensi representasi data

BARIS
Syarat Dasar Database Relasional

KUNCI
UTAMA

NILAI KUNCI ASING


TUNGGAL

ATRIBUT
NONKUNCI
Operasi Dasar Database

Create database Drop database Create table Drop table


Pembuatan basis data Penghapusan basis data Pembuatan table suatu Penghapusan tabel
baru baris data suatu baris data

Insert Retrieve / Search Update Delete


Menambah data baru Pengambilan data dari Pengubahan data pada Pengahpusan data
tabel tabel dalam tabel
Field (Kolom)

Sales
Sales Sales Invoice Customer

Database
Date Customer Street City
Invoice # Person Total Name
Record (Baris)
101 01/03/2021 J. Buck 151 1447 D. Ainge Lotus AZ
Atau Tuple
101
102
01/03/2021 J. Buck
01/03/2021 S. Knight
151
152
1447 D. Ainge Lotus
4394 G. Kite
AZ
Quatro AZ Relasional

Kartu Persediaan

Customer
Customer # Street City
Name

151 D. Ainge Lotus AZ


152 G. Kite Quatro AZ
Customer
Tidak mudah mengakomodasi
integrasi jenis data yang kompleks
(grafik,suara,peta) dengan text dan
data numeric yang terkait dengan
pengolahan transaksi

Tidak efisien untuk pengolahan


transaksi dan memerlukan memory
Kelebihan yang lebih besar dibanding file-based
Plus DBMS
Minus
Meningkatkan kecepatan dan
kemudahan pengaksesan data Kelemahan
secara signifikan 

Memudahkan perancangan sistem


informasi akuntansi dan sistem
informasi lain untuk memenuhi
kebutuhan unit-unit dalam organisasi
Berorientasi
Objek
Sistem basis data yang menggunakan
model data dalam bentuk yang
digunakan bahasa pemrograman
berorientasi objek. Aplikasi berbasis
BDBO menyimpan dan mengambil data
dalam bentuk asli sesuai dengan
format yang digunakan oleh aplikasi
Berorientasi Objek
Mampu menangani jenis data yang
01
01 kompleks

Model data berfungsi untuk proyek


02
02 telekomunikasi dan sejenisnya

Kelebihan
dan
Kekurangan
01
01
Tidak ada standar query yang mudah

Encapsulation memungkinkan sebuah objek


02
02 digunakan kembali,namun jika terlalu ekstrim
maka konsep ini dapat menghilangkan
kemampauan untuk melakukan query-khusus
Pengguna Database

01
Databese
Manager
02
Database
Administrator
03
Database
User
Pemanfaatan Database

Bidang Fungsional Bentuk Perusahaan

Kepegawaian Perbankan

Pergudangan (Inventory) Rumah sakit

Akuntansi Produsen Barang

Reservasi Sekolah

Layanan Pelanggan,dll Telekomunikasi,dll


Database
1. Diperlukan hardware yang lebih kuat,
terminal yang lebih banyak, alat
komunikasi.
2. Biaya Performance yang lebih besar
3. Rawannya keberhasilan operasi
Keuntungan 4. Sistem kelihatan lebih kompleks

1. Mengurangi redudansi data


2.
3.
Integritas data
Menghindari inkonsisten data
Kerugian
4. Penggunaan data bersama
5. Standarisasi data
6. Jaminan keamanan data
7. Menyeimbangkan kebutuhan data
Thank you

Anda mungkin juga menyukai